Output 354a603ce65d2a24a6381c1475bc6eb9c0feef15ded0cc59d8820efbf90398cf:0

value
300000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5350eb9a8bb12448420c9e5c8ba0fff41bce38b1 OP_EQUAL
address
39HYwueexhHkbTH8mf5m3GCPD1PUdHCGwK
transaction
354a603ce65d2a24a6381c1475bc6eb9c0feef15ded0cc59d8820efbf90398cf
confirmations
379324
spent
true